The amplitude of a damped oscillator decreases to 0.9 times its original magnitude in 5s. In another 10s it will decrease to α times its original magnitude, where α equals :
  1. 0.729
  2. 0.6
  3. 0.7
  4. 0.81

Solution

A=A0 e-bt2m

After 5 second

0.9 A 0 = A 0  e - b 5 2 m    ...... (i)

After 10 more second

A = A 0  e - b 1 5 2 m      ...... (ii)

From (i) and (ii)

A = 0.729 A 0
